<pre>We have view > field shadings / ctrl+f8 to always identify fields (and some
formatting marks). Speaking more generally you don't want to see fields but a
kind of pixel-perfect print preview. And this variable input is rather a
constant not meant to flexible enter data like done with form > text box, and
other. So my take => WF.
